Autumn Scanlon
I am an elite athlete and trainer. I currently play semi-professional soccer, for the Rhode Island Rogues FC, in the Women’s Premier Soccer League (WPSL). I am also an Elite (OCR) obstacle racer. I was recently at a professional soccer tryout, in January 2020, when I broke my foot. Unfortunately, due to COVID, the next tryout opportunity is TBD.

I also just recently completed my first marathon, after the 10 month recovery, from my foot surgery, back in January. I placed 10th in my age group (25-29) and have gone on to register for the Canyon Endurance race, in April. With the hopes of qualifying for a spot at the Western 100, in 2022.
